Cedar River Water And Sewer District
Replace existing diesel pump fire pump system with electrical vertical in-line booster pump (pump No. 3). Replace pump No. 1 and pump No. 2. Provide temp bypass pumping with backup power. Provide new mechanical piping, valves, flow meter, and water quality analyzer. Install an outdoor-rated 250 kW generator with sub-base diesel fuel tank. Upsize utility pole-mount transformers, secondary conductors, and conduit. Replace 200-amp rated electrical service and distribution equipment with 400-amp rated equipment. Install a VFD for new pump No. 3. Replace step-down transformer inside the building, pump No. 1 and pump No. 2 VFDs, and building overhead lights, outdoor lights, and site light.
City of Aubrey
Construction of the 0.72-mgd rockhill pump station, and the 0.40-mg awwa d100 welded steel ground storage reservoir, 2,592 SY of 8" thick reinforced concrete pavement, 1,318 LF of 12" waterline, along with necessary appurtenances to make the pump station and ground storage reservoir functional and operational.

Omaha Metropolitan Utilities District
Install the lakewood booster pump station and water mains. The new Lakewood Booster Pump Station will be a packaged pump station with the pumps and instruments included. Huffman Engineering will provide a new PLC pump control panel, PLC Programming, Citect Scada programming at Systems Control and onsite checkout and startup. A new Citect SCADA screen will be created at MUD Systems Control to allow for remote monitoring and control. The pump booster station will have 3 pumps, but one pump will be hardwired with local controls with no connection to the pump control panel and there will be no monitoring. Communication from the PLC to the 2 new Pump VFDs will be via Profibus.
